The best possible hand in the game of cribbage equates to 29 points.

For this to be made you have to be initially dealt;

One Jack, and 3 Fives, with the turned card being the other 5 in the same suit of your Jack.

This hand then makes:

8 lots of 15´s = 16 points

6 lots of pairs = 12 points

and the matching Jack to the 5 = 1 point

16 + 12 + 1 = 29

Does a flush score points in cribbage?

Yes, it does. In your dealt hand if you have 4 cards of the same suit you get 4 points. In order to get points in the crib, all 5 cards must be the same suit, in which case you would get 5 points.
